Garbo fruit is a fruit tree of the myrtle family Pseudo-fragrant peach tree, also known as Xiao Tamarix myrtle, Jumbo Fruit, Erotic Tree, Delicious Tropical Grapes, Tree Grapes, etc., belonging to the tropical subtropical evergreen shrub. The growth of Garbo fruit is slow at the young stage, the branch branching and branching ability is strong, the tree posture is open, the crown is naturally round-headed, the root distribution is shallow, the depth is less than 70 cm, mainly the whisker roots. The bark is thin , off-white or pale brown to reddish , with a slow shedding character ; clusters of flowers grow on the main trunk and main branches , and sometimes on new branches.

Garbo fruit flowers lag behind, small young fruits grow in groups of three or five, from green to red and then purple, and finally into purple-black, can bloom and bear fruit many times a year.

The fruit of Garbo fruit is dark purple, juicy and sweet, rich in nutrients, its protein, sugar, fat, fiber content, vitamin B2, vitamin C content are 0.0019, 0.2167mg / g, respectively, in the common melon fruit belongs to a high level, mineral content of up to 2.8% to 3.8% (in terms of dry mass). The appearance, size and shape of the gerbera fruit are similar to those of grapes, and when compared, their nutritional content is also closest to that of grapes. After testing, the fruit of garbo fruit contains more than 40 kinds of aromatic components such as terpenes, esters, alcohols, etc., and is rich in polyphenolic compounds such as anthocyanins, quercetin, rutin, gallic acid, tannin, etc., with a wide range of biological activities.

The fruit is rich in anthocyanins and phenols and other substances with strong ant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, bacteriostatic, antidiarrheal, antidiarrheal, prevention of diabetes and obesity and other chronic diseases. After research, the seed antioxidant capacity of garbo fruit is the strongest, followed by peel and pulp, and the antioxidant capacity is positively correlated with the content of active substances contained.

In addition to the fruit, the leaves of the garbo fruit are also of great use, especially for diabetes. Diabetes mellitus is a complex chronic metabolic disease characterized by hyperglycemia and metabolic disorders of three major nutrients, including sugar, fat, and protein. Oxidative stress is a common pathway of different pathogenesis of many chronic complications of diabetes, and antioxidants can block the oxidative stress damage pathway, showing an increasingly important role in the treatment of diabetes. The leaves of garbo fruit contain a large number of flavonoids and polyphenol secondary metabolites, which have outstanding effects in antioxidant and inhibition of α-glucosidase, and can effectively play hypoglycemic effects.
